The most noticeable aspect of the celebrations will be a full set of new jerseys that will be worn this season.

The B’s confirmed last week that they will be sporting a new home jersey, away jersey, and alternate jersey this year.

The alternates will be worn against Original Six teams and (I think) on the aforementioned eras nights; the home and aways will be worn all other times.

All three jerseys will be unveiled at a team event on Sept. 16, though they’ll likely leak before that.
